Inconel® 601

UNS N06601 | W.Nr. 2.4851 | Alloy 601

Inconel 601 is a nickel-chromium-iron alloy with an addition of aluminum for outstanding resistance to high-temperature oxidation. It is particularly known for its ability to resist spalling oxide scales even under severe thermal cycling conditions.

Why Choose Inconel 601?

Inconel 601 is the material of choice for the most demanding thermal processing equipment. While Inconel 600 is excellent for general heat resistance, the addition of Aluminum in 601 allows it to form a tightly adherent oxide scale that protects the material even when subjected to repeated heating and cooling cycles.

Cyclic Oxidation Resistance

The aluminum content ensures the protective oxide layer remains intact during thermal cycling, preventing the scaling and spalling that destroys lesser alloys.

High Mechanical Strength

Retains high tensile strength and ductility after long-term service exposure at elevated temperatures.

Résistance à la cémentation

Excellent resistance to carburization and carbonitriding conditions, making it ideal for heat treating baskets and fixtures.

Composition chimique (%)
Élément Contenu (%)
Nickel (Ni) 58.0 - 63.0
Chrome (Cr) 21.0 - 25.0
Fer (Fe) Équilibre
Aluminium (Al) 1.0 - 1.7
Carbone (C) 0,10 max
Manganèse (Mn) 1,0 max
Silicium (Si) 0,5 max

*Note: The addition of Aluminum is the key differentiator from Inconel 600.

Spécifications standard
Forme du produit Normes ASTM / ASME
Tubes et tuyaux (sans soudure) ASTM B167, ASME SB167
Plaque, feuille, bande ASTM B168, ASME SB168
Bar & Rod ASTM B166, ASME SB166
Raccords ASTM B366, ASME SB366
Forgeage ASTM B564, ASME SB564
Propriétés mécaniques (recuit de mise en solution)
Propriété Valeurs typiques (température ambiante)
Résistance à la traction 80 - 100 ksi (550 - 690 MPa)
Limite d'élasticité (décalage de 0,2%) 30 - 50 ksi (205 - 345 MPa)
Élongation 30 - 55 %
Dureté (Brinell) 120 - 170 HB
Applications typiques

Traitement thermique

Radiant tubes, muffles, retorts, flame shields, and strand-annealing tubes used in industrial furnaces.

Traitement chimique

Insulating cans in ammonia reformers and catalyst support grids in nitric acid production.

Lutte contre la pollution

Thermal reactors in exhaust systems of gasoline engines and waste incinerators.

Production d'électricité

Superheater tube supports, grid barriers, and ash handling systems.
